    The National Rifle Association’s annual convention is returning to Indianapolis—twice.

    Visit Indy signed a deal in December to bring the NRA’s massive annual show back to the Indiana Convention Center in 2019 and 2023, city tourism officials confirmed.Indianapolis hosted the NRA event for the first time last April, and the convention drew 75,267 attendees, the second highest in the convention’s history, following a record of 86,228 in Houston in 2013.
    “We had one of our best meetings ever last year in Indianapolis,” NRA spokesman Andrew Arulanandam said. “I can’t say enough about the convention center and Visit Indy staff. They have a world-class operation there, and our members had an absolutely great time. This was an easy decision for us.”
